14:22 — Waveform preview outage, Chordline player. Previews rendered blank for uploads after 13:50. Root cause: the waveform renderer picked up a malformed codec table from the 13:45 deploy. Mitigation: rolled back renderer pods at 14:31; backlog reprocessed by 15:10. No audio playback impact, previews only. Action items filed against the Soundrail team for codec table validation. The offending deploy is identified by the build token below.

pipeline stamp: htk31_f769b577b3028a4e9958e5bb8d1259a

**Ticket TURN-88: Gatevane turnstile counter double-counts on rapid re-entry**

Repro:
1. Spin up the Gatevane sandbox gate.
2. Swipe the same pass twice within 300ms.
3. Query /counts — total increments by 2, expected 1.

Plugin authors: verify your hooks don't debounce. To query the sandbox counts endpoint, authenticate with the bearer token below.

login token, kajef-bageg: eyJhbGciOiJIUzI1NiIsInR5cCI6IkpXVCJ9.eyJzdWIiOiIH5ZQCtYjwtIn0.4vgGyGsw5y_7

Attendees: Dara, Milo, Fenna, plus sales leads. Dara walked through the draft term sheet from Kestrel Dynamics covering co-selling rights for the Opaline platform. Discussion focused on exclusivity scope, revenue share tiers, and the two-year renewal clause. Milo flagged concerns about territory overlap in the Varn region. Legal review is due Friday; no commitments until then. Sales leads should hold pricing conversations. The negotiating position is recorded in the confidential note below.

internal memo for yahag-hahig: Belwynix Group plans to lower the Silir list price by 62 percent in May.